The Economy

The topic was the economy. The Conservatives hammered the Liberals on Canada being the only G20 country in a recession and having poor economic growth. In response, the Liberals mostly talked up recent cash payments to Canadians to help with high living costs, and cited some positive job numbers released the same day. The debate was highly partisan with both sides mostly just repeating their same talking points over and over.
